深入解读以太坊HD钱包及其应用
引言
以太坊(Ethereum)是一种基于区块链技术的开源平台,能够实现去中心化应用和智能合约的执行。随着以太坊生态系统的不断扩展,安全性和存储效率成为用户关注的重点。在这个背景下,HD(Hierarchical Deterministic)钱包的出现,为以太坊用户提供了一种安全、高效且便捷的存储解决方案。
HD钱包的概念及工作原理
HD钱包是一种能够自动生成子地址的钱包,其核心理念是用一个主助记词生成无限数量的私钥和公钥。这种结构允许用户在不同场景下采用不同的地址进行交易,提高了安全性和隐私保护。
HD钱包的生成流程主要包括以下几个步骤:
- 助记词生成:用户在创建HD钱包时,系统会生成一组助记词,通常有12个或24个单词组成。这些助记词是钱包的根密钥,用户需要妥善保存。
- BIP32与BIP44标准:HD钱包遵循Blockchaining Improvement Proposal(BIP)32和BIP44标准,BIP32定义了如何从根密钥生成子密钥,而BIP44则定义了多币种钱包的层级结构。
- 地址生成:通过主助记词,可以生成多个子私钥及其对应的公共地址,用户可以在各类交易中使用不同的地址,而不需要担心管理多个私钥的麻烦。
- 交易签名:当用户需要进行交易时,使用对应的私钥对交易进行签名,确保交易的安全与有效性。
以太坊HD钱包的优势
以太坊HD钱包相较于传统钱包具有明显的优势:
- 用户友好:通过助记词,用户可轻松管理多个地址,无需记住多个私钥。
- 增强隐私性:每次交易可使用不同的地址,降低了“地址可追溯性”带来的隐私风险。
- 简化恢复过程:一旦丢失设备或应用,用户可使用助记词轻松恢复钱包内的所有资产。
- 多币种支持:按照BIP44标准,HD钱包可以支持多种加密货币,方便用户管理不同币种。
常见的以太坊HD钱包工具
目前,有多款知名的以太坊HD钱包工具可供用户选择:
- MetaMask:作为一款流行的浏览器插件钱包,MetaMask支持以太坊和ERC20代币,用户可以轻松管理资产并进行去中心化交易。
- MyEtherWallet(MEW):MEW是一款开源的以太坊钱包,为用户提供HD钱包的功能,支持自定义交易和离线签名等。
- Ledger Nano S/X:硬件钱包提供高安全性的存储方案,支持HD钱包功能,适合长期存储数字资产。
- Trezor:另一款非常安全的硬件钱包,支持多种加密货币,也涵盖以太坊HD钱包功能。
问题探讨
什么是以太坊HD钱包的安全性?
以太坊HD钱包的安全性是用户最为关心的问题之一。HD钱包通过助记词生成私钥的方式,相较于传统钱包具有更高的安全性。不过,这也取决于用户如何安全地管理和储存助记词。
首先,HD钱包的安全性依赖于用户的助记词。助记词一旦泄露,任何人都可以访问用户的钱包。因此,用户应该将助记词存储在一个安全的地方,比如纸质形式或冷存储设备中,避免将其存在联网设备上。
其次,使用硬件钱包可以提供额外的安全保护。硬件钱包将私钥存储在物理设备中,与互联网隔离,减少了黑客攻击的可能性。同时,即使设备被盗,黑客依然无法在没有助记词的情况下访问钱包。
此外,用户还需定期更新钱包软件,确保其始终在最新版本,以避免安全漏洞。选择声誉良好的钱包供应商也是至关重要的,这样可以更好地保障用户的资产安全。
如何选择适合的以太坊HD钱包?
选择适合自己的以太坊HD钱包需要考虑多个因素,包括安全性、易用性、支持的币种等。
首先,安全性是最优先考虑的因素。用户应选择知名度高、用户评价好的钱包,比如MetaMask或硬件钱包(如Ledger和Trezor),这些钱包在安全性和用户反馈上相对较好。
其次,易用性也非常重要,不同用户的技术水平不同,选择符合自身操作习惯的钱包非常必要。某些钱包界面友好,容易操作,适合初学者;而另一些钱包则可能更适用于技术较为熟悉的用户。
再者,支持的币种要符合用户投资的需求。有些HD钱包只支持以太坊及其代币,而其他钱包则可能支持多种区块链资产,选择时需根据自己的投资方向适当选择。
最后,对于需要频繁交易的用户,选择一款与DeFi和DApp适配性良好的钱包同样是必要的,这会增加操作的便捷性。
以太坊HD钱包如何实现资产管理?
以太坊HD钱包通过分层结构和助记词生成的方式,让用户在资产管理上增加了灵活性和隐私性。具体来说,用户可以为不同的项目或用途创建子账户,用于清晰管理资产。
使用HD钱包,用户可以为每种交易或目的生成不同的地址,便于追踪和管理。例如,用户可以为日常交易、长期持有、投资等分别使用不同的地址,避免资金混淆,便于清晰记录。
此外,HD钱包中的资产管理界面一般都设计得十分直观,用户可以轻松查看不同地址中的余额,图表和历史交易记录也有助于用户更好地把握资产流动状况。
同时,HD钱包也支持一些高级功能,例如将某些资产标记为“冷存储”,即将其保存在不联网的状态,以确保它们的安全。此外,用户还可以借助钱包内置的功能,将资产转移到其他钱包地址,实现一键转账。
以太坊HD钱包的未来趋势如何?
作为一个发展迅速的技术,HD钱包在加密货币领域正展现出新的趋势。随着去中心化金融(DeFi)和各种基于区块链的应用不断涌现,HD钱包的需求和功能也将不断演进。
首先,用户对隐私和安全的关注确保HD钱包会继续朝着更高安全性方向发展。未来的新型HD钱包可能会集成生物特征识别等多重验证方式,增强用户资产的安全保护。
其次,用户体验的也将是发展重点。随着技术的不断成熟,HD钱包将越来越注重用户界面的友好性,减少复杂操作,提升交易的便捷性和流畅度。
还有,在多链支持方面,HD钱包可能会发展成为一个综合性资产管理工具,允许用户在同一个平台上管理跨多个区块链的资产,提高了用户的便利性。
此外,随着DeFi应用的普及,HD钱包还将可能与更多的金融服务集成,直接支持贷币、抵押、交易和收益等多种功能。
以太坊HD钱包如何处理交易费用?
在以太坊网络上进行交易时,用户需要支付一定的交易费用,通常以“Gas”来计算。HD钱包在处理交易费用时,可以提供多种设置和选择,以便用户控制资金流动。
用户在发起交易时,可以选择交易的Gas价格,与网络的拥堵程度相适应。一般来说,Gas价格越高,交易确认的速度就越快,适合需要快速交易的情况。
此外,一些HD钱包支持自动估算Gas费用,为用户提供建议,帮助用户选择合适的交易费用,避免因Gas费用设置过低而导致交易延迟或失败。
用户也需意识到,定义交易费用时,需把握好成本与速度的平衡,尤其在快速波动的市场中,如何合理安排交易成本将直接影响到投资收益。
总结
以太坊HD钱包凭借其去中心化、隐私性强及管理方便的特性,成为日益流行的加密货币存储解决方案。在实施与发展过程中,用户应保持一定的安全意识,合理选择适合自己的工具,并且在交易时密切关注市场变化,灵活调配自己的资产。
未来随着技术的进步,HD钱包将会提供更多创新的功能,而用户在选择和操作时,也需持续提升自己的认知与使用技巧,以便更好地适应这个快速发展的加密世界。